Alimera Sciences (NASDAQ:ALIM) Receives New Coverage from Analysts at StockNews.com

StockNews.com began coverage on shares of Alimera Sciences (NASDAQ:ALIMFree Report) in a research report report published on Sunday morning. The brokerage issued a hold rating on the biopharmaceutical company’s stock.

A number of other equities research analysts have also recently commented on the stock. HC Wainwright cut shares of Alimera Sciences from a buy rating to a neutral rating and set a $6.00 target price for the company. in a report on Tuesday, June 25th. Maxim Group reaffirmed a hold rating on shares of Alimera Sciences in a research report on Tuesday, June 25th. Finally, Alliance Global Partners reiterated a neutral rating on shares of Alimera Sciences in a research note on Tuesday, June 25th.

Alimera Sciences Stock Performance

ALIM opened at $5.54 on Friday. The company has a quick ratio of 2.62, a current ratio of 2.79 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.80. Alimera Sciences has a 52 week low of $2.61 and a 52 week high of $5.65. The business’s 50 day moving average is $5.55 and its two-hundred day moving average is $4.47. The firm has a market cap of $290.24 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of -3.53 and a beta of 1.25.

Alimera Sciences (NASDAQ:ALIMG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Tuesday, August 6th. The biopharmaceutical company reported ($0.06) EPS for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of ($0.04) by ($0.02). The business had revenue of $27.00 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$25.76 million. Alimera Sciences had a negative net margin of 14.74% and a negative return on equity of 33.70%. On average, research analysts predict that Alimera Sciences will post -0.13 EPS for the current year.

Hedge Funds Weigh In On Alimera Sciences

Several institutional investors and hedge funds have recently added to or reduced their stakes in the business. Deltec Asset Management LLC acquired a new stake in shares of Alimera Sciences in the 2nd quarter valued at approximately $690,000. Vanguard Group Inc. raised its position in Alimera Sciences by 61.1% in the first quarter. Vanguard Group Inc. now owns 1,045,460 shares of the biopharmaceutical company’s stock worth $4,077,000 after acquiring an additional 396,506 shares in the last quarter. Ancora Advisors LLC acquired a new stake in Alimera Sciences in the first quarter valued at $915,000. Glazer Capital LLC purchased a new stake in shares of Alimera Sciences during the 2nd quarter worth $3,067,000. Finally, Fifth Lane Capital LP purchased a new stake in shares of Alimera Sciences during the 1st quarter worth $83,000. Institutional investors and hedge funds own 99.83% of the company’s stock.

Alimera Sciences, Inc, a pharmaceutical company, develops and commercializes prescription ophthalmic retinal pharmaceuticals. It operates through United States, International, and Operating Cost segments. The company offers ILUVIEN, a fluocinolone acetonide intravitreal implant for the treatment of diabetic macular edema (DME), which is a disease of the retina that affects individuals with diabetes and can lead to severe vision loss and blindness; and to prevent relapse in recurrent non-infectious uveitis affecting the posterior segment of the eye (NIU-PS).
